Curve 19550bb1

19550 = 2 · 52 · 17 · 23



Data for elliptic curve 19550bb1

Field Data Notes
Atkin-Lehner 2- 5+ 17+ 23- Signs for the Atkin-Lehner involutions
Class 19550bb Isogeny class
Conductor 19550 Conductor
∏ cp 40 Product of Tamagawa factors cp
deg 51840 Modular degree for the optimal curve
Δ -6497442500000 = -1 · 25 · 57 · 173 · 232 Discriminant
Eigenvalues 2-  1 5+  2  2 -1 17+ -1 Hecke eigenvalues for primes up to 20
Equation [1,0,0,-45563,3741617] [a1,a2,a3,a4,a6]
Generators [92:529:1] Generators of the group modulo torsion
j -669485563505641/415836320 j-invariant
L 9.6597460379184 L(r)(E,1)/r!
Ω 0.7432743956484 Real period
R 0.32490511224632 Regulator
r 1 Rank of the group of rational points
S 1 (Analytic) order of Ш
t 1 Number of elements in the torsion subgroup
Twists 3910g1 Quadratic twists by: 5
